Police name Portsmouth man who spat at officer claiming he had coronavirus

A MAN who coughed and spat at a police officer after claiming he had coronavirus has appeared in court.

Scott Sleet, 42, of Dursley Crescent, Portsmouth, has been charged with assaulting an emergency worker and being drunk and disorderly in a public place.

It comes following the incident in Olinda Street, Portsmouth, at 10.10pm on Saturday (March 28).

Sleet appeared at Portsmouth Magistrates’ Court this morning and was bailed with conditions to appear next in court on May 12.
